gpt4 book ai didi

algorithm - Shellsort - 如果一个数组是 g-sorted 然后 h-sorted,数组仍然是 g-sorted

转载 作者:塔克拉玛干 更新时间:2023-11-03 05:23:18 26 4
gpt4 key购买 nike

以下是来自普林斯顿的 coursera 算法类(class)的练习。

如果一个数组既是 3 次排序又是 5 次排序,那么它是否也是 6 次、7 次、8 次、9 次和 10 次排序?我知道任何序列如果先 g-sorted 然后 h-sorted,它仍然是 g-sorted。但这如何解释这个问题呢?如果数组是 3 排序和 5 排序,它与 6 排序或 7 排序等有什么关系?提前致谢!

最佳答案

好吧,关于 6、9 和 10 排序,这些只是基本排序运行中的替代条目(例如,6 排序是 3 排序中的每隔一个条目)。所以你可以说对于一个h排序的数组,这个数组也是kh排序的,其中k是一个大于0的正整数。8排序理解起来有点棘手,但是说这个数组是8就足够了-排序,因为 8 是 3 和 5 的和。出于类似的原因,我们可以说数组不是 7 排序的,因为你不能从 5 和 3 构造 7。

关于algorithm - Shellsort - 如果一个数组是 g-sorted 然后 h-sorted,数组仍然是 g-sorted,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/24590229/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com